What is the low metal formulation for friction linings?

Understanding Low Metal Formulation

In the world of automotive friction materials, the term "low metal formulation" often pops up. This refers to brake pads and linings that contain a reduced amount of metallic components compared to traditional options. It's important to understand this formulation as it plays a crucial role in the performance and durability of braking systems.

What Constitutes Low Metal Formulation?

Low metal formulations typically include a blend of organic materials with a small percentage of metals. The general composition may consist of:

  • Friction modifiers
  • Binders
  • Reinforcement fibers
  • A limited quantity of copper, steel, or other metals

Advantages of Low Metal Formulations

So why choose low metal brake pads? Here are some compelling reasons:

  • Reduced Noise: One of the most significant benefits is the reduction in braking noise. The absence of high metal content diminishes vibrations that can lead to squeaking sounds during braking.
  • Lower Dust Production: These formulations produce significantly less brake dust compared to traditional pads, contributing to cleaner wheels and brake components.
  • Enhanced Performance: Low metal formulations provide excellent stopping power, especially in moderate driving conditions. They offer a good balance between performance and comfort.

Challenges and Considerations

While the advantages are clear, it's essential to recognize some challenges associated with low metal formulations:

  • Temperature Sensitivity: Low metal pads may not perform as well under extreme temperatures, which can affect braking efficiency during heavy use.
  • Compatibility Issues: Not all vehicles are suited for low metal pads. Some might require traditional formulations for optimal performance.

Environmental Considerations

Another aspect worth mentioning is the environmental impact of low metal formulations. Traditionally, brake pads containing higher metal concentrations have raised concerns regarding particulate emissions and their effects on air quality. Low metal formulations aim to address these concerns by reducing harmful elements, thus making them more eco-friendly.
